How they compare
Sub-Saharan Africa currently reports 208.50 million current US$ against 81.48 million current US$ in Kuwait, a difference of 127.02 million current US$.
That makes Sub-Saharan Africa's figure about 2.6 times Kuwait's.
Across all 9 years both countries report, Sub-Saharan Africa has been ahead every year.
Kuwait ranks 15th and Sub-Saharan Africa ranks 13th of 68 countries.
Sub-Saharan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
